Output e35b0e7a64407441820687fc88e503cb1520e89beafbc1e3f448310c7c04b3d2: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fd89268407cb56f910f0cddda06e1e6361cace8 OP_EQUAL
address
338oW6oX6MRfrhxqwRz2jBbV4pMaFEvQJW
transaction
e35b0e7a64407441820687fc88e503cb1520e89beafbc1e3f448310c7c04b3d2
confirmations
162825
spent
true